API removals or changes: PVP suggests a major version bump
Dependencies added: array, validity-text
API changes (from Hackage documentation)
- Data.GenValidity.Text: genUncheckedText :: Gen Text
+ Data.GenValidity.Text: instance Data.GenValidity.GenValidity Data.Text.Internal.Text
- Data.GenValidity.Text: textWithoutAnyOf :: [Char] -> Gen Text
+ Data.GenValidity.Text: textWithoutAnyOf :: String -> Gen Text
